ENSCO Avionics, Inc. is seeking Hardware Engineers with experience in full life cycle development for Avionics Electromagnetic Interference (EMI) design systems. Initial work will include requirements through design of EMI test environments for Avionic flight and engine control systems and Hybrid power and drive systems with continued development through build and integration stages of the project. Candidate will be responsible from design to lead activities including requirements analysis, test environment design, creating test plans, test reports, test support, post analysis, and final report generation. Candidate will also monitor test method and performance aspects needed for future proposals. Throughout the cycle the position will utilize industry best practice systems engineering and development processes and will consider both the business and the technical needs of the end user with the goal of providing a quality product that satisfies those needs. Designs are developed in Word, Excel, VISIO drawing suite with end documents maintained in Windchill. EMI Tests are run utilizing the TILE! Test suite.
